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Erith to Kintore start from as little as £63.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Erith to Kintore start from £113.60 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Erith to Kintore are available for £237.40 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Erith Station

At Erith Station, ease of access is at the heart of the services offered. If you’re purchasing tickets, not only are there ticket machines available, but you can also collect tickets purchased online. The station is equipped with smartcard readers, making it easy for local commuters who prefer touch-free travel.

For travelers who require a bit more help, there is staff available from Monday through Saturday, from 06:10 to 19:25, to assist with any questions. Although luggage storage is not available, the station holds a Secure Station accreditation for your peace of mind, with staff ready to assist if needed. However, be advised that there are no facilities for storing your luggage, but the presence of CCTV should give travelers added peace of mind.

Erith also offers step-free access to platform 2, with clear signage and helpful staff ready to assist passengers with reduced mobility. For those looking to grab a quick coffee before embarking on their journey, a café and coffee kiosk are conveniently situated in the station. Though there are no ATM facilities at Erith, travelers can find pay phones should they need them.

Facilities and Accessibility at Kintore

Kintore Train Station ensures a hassle-free travel experience despite not having a ticket office. Travelers can utilize the ticket machines available for buying and collecting tickets, with accessible ticket machines ensuring everyone can use them effortlessly. The induction loop system further supports those with hearing impairments. Although there is a lack of staff assistance on-site, the customer help points can offer guidance if needed.

Emphasizing accessibility, the entire station boasts step-free access, making it simple for passengers with mobility challenges to navigate. There are 12 accessible parking spaces available in the station's car park with CCTV surveillance, ensuring your vehicle's safety while you explore. While there are no refreshment or shop facilities, the practical design focuses on what truly matters: getting you to your destination quickly and securely.

Onward Travel from Kintore

Kintore Train Station is seamlessly integrated into the local transport network. For bus enthusiasts, a convenient stop is located just 300 meters outside the station on the B987. Those requiring taxi services can find detailed information at TrainTaxi. If your travel plans extend to international skies, Dyce Station is approximately nine miles away from Aberdeen Airport, offering a gateway to the world.
